Nutrients in Babyfood, dinner, vegetables chicken, strained
100 grams of Babyfood, dinner, vegetables chicken, strained contain 2.47 grams of protein, 1.73 grams of fat, 8.42 grams of carbohydrates, and 2.1 grams of fiber.
You have 59 calories from 100 grams of Babyfood, dinner, vegetables chicken, strained, the 3% of your total daily needs. It contains 1.73 grams of fat and 11 mg of Cholesterol.
Some minerals can be present in Babyfood, dinner, vegetables chicken, strained, such as Potassium (158 mg), Phosphorus (47 mg) or Calcium (27 mg) but no Fluoride.
It contains some important vitamins: Vitamin B-9 (5 mg), Vitamin A (4,132 IU) or Vitamin K (3.4 µg).
